Study to Assess Absolute Bioavailability of TAK-935 (OV935) and to Characterize Mass Balance, Pharmacokinetics, Metabolism, and Excretion of [14C]TAK-935 (OV935) in Healthy Male Participants
NCT04992442 · Status: COMPLETED · Phase: PHASE1 · Type: INTERVENTIONAL · Enrollment: 6
Last updated 2021-10-04
Summary
The purpose of this study is to determine absolute bioavailability (ABA) of TAK-935 (F) following a single microdose intravenous (IV) administration of 50 microgram (μg) (approximately 1 microcurie \[μCi\]) \[14C\]TAK-935 and a single oral administration of 3×100 mg milligram (mg) TAK-935 tablets in Treatment Period 1, and to assess the mass balance, characterize the pharmacokinetics (PK) of TAK-935 and metabolite \[M-I (N-oxide)\] in plasma and urine, and total radioactivity concentration equivalents in plasma and whole blood following a single oral administration of 300 mg (approximately 100 μCi) \[14C\]TAK-935 in Treatment Period 2.
